Names Memphis, I have a 260z that I fell into for a couple hundred dollars. It came with a clifford intake and holley 390cfm and the timing was really off. The previous owner had put a large washer on the distributor adjustment bolt so he could advance it way further than it should. It drove terrible at low RPMS but really kicked in around 5grand. I picked up motor from a friend thats a running '76 L28e. Im really considering swapping all the 4bbl stuff onto the L28 and getting some forged pistons for it and looking into head work at a machine shop in my local area. Id like to build a motor for top end. Im looking for a little advice on the two motors I have before I get to far ahead of myself. The L28 seems to.have a better aftermarket then the L26.
